- Abstract : Front Cover : A perylene bisimide derivative (PBI) as a role of sensitizer forms the charge transfer (CT) complex with the polymer matrix of poly(4‐(diphenylamino)benzyl acrylate) (PDAA) in a photorefractive composite system. This formation favorizes the generation of the charge carriers followed by an effective enhancement in the photo‐refractive performances. Interestingly, with only small amount (0.1 wt%) of PBI, an external diffraction efficiency of 49% with response time of 47 ms, and sensitivity of 28 cm 2 J −1 can be obtained under an applied electric field of 40 V μm −1 at writing beam of 532 nm.
